Course Description
In light of the COVID-19 pandemic and the heated tensions between US and China, it is challenging for in-house counsel and their corporate companies to run their businesses and practices under the new normal. In this event, we would share with you the challenges and opportunities that corporate in-house counsel may encounter amid these difficult times, focusing on the areas of Anti-Money Laundering and US-China relations.
We have invited two distinguished speakers to share their views in this in-house conference.
